Woodcock Nature Center’s annual wreath decorating festival is scheduled for Dec. 3 through Dec. 14.

Participants can create wreaths at one of the weeknight “Ladies’ Nights” or Saturday “Family Day” open houses using an array of natural dried flowers, grasses, nuts, fruits, berries and cones. All materials are provided to create a unique balsam holiday wreath.

Proceeds benefit the Woodcock Nature Center’s Environmental Education Initiative.

More than 700 people have signed up so far, but a few spots still remain for “Ladies’ Nights” which run Tuesday through Friday, Dec. 3 through Dec. 13, at either 6:30 to 8:15 and 8:30 to 10:15. Participants may bring food and drink

Tickets at $50 are available online at www.woodcocknaturecenter.org.

Open house “Family Day” will be Saturday, Dec. 7 and Saturday, Dec. 14 from 12 to 4 p.m. (no pre-registration required). The fee is $40 with a $10 discount for any ladies who also signed up for “Ladies’ Night.”
